This is because Sw2 is the DR and sees itself as the one in charge of
announcing routes. DR listen to LSA on multicast address 224.0.0.6 and then
it announces it to 224.0.0.5 i.e all ospf routers.
It will not accept routes on multicast address 224.0.0.5
Sw1 on the other hand doesnt believe in DR so it will send directly its
routes to 224.0.0.5
Of course Sw2 will ignore it.

> I am doing OSPF labs and found a peculiar thing . I have two 3560 switches
> connected to each other SW1---------------Sw2 back to back . the two fast
> ethernet links are running OSPF and i enable network type as point-to-point
> on SW1 and broadcast on SW2. I find it really puzzling to se that they
> formed neighborship but they r not exchanging their databases. I heard in
> one of the Brians INE ATC which says that the compatible network types are
>
> Point to point-----point to point
> Point to point ---point to multipoint
> point to mulitpoint-----point to multipoint
>
> Broadcast--Broadcast
> Broadcast---NonBroadcast
> NonBroadcast-----NonBroadcast
>
> But here i can see that a point to point network type can form neighborship
> with the broadcast network type .But they not exchanging the routes I am
> not
> able to reach SW1 loopback from SW2 even though SW1 is advertising its
> loopback in OSPF. I want to know the LOGIC behind it .? they r forming
> neighborship but they are not exchanging routes? How is this possible?
>
> And also in which OSPF packet type they will exchange the NETWORK TYPES of
> both switches and how the OSPF running switches comes to now about the
> other sides network Type.
